What is Zoom Video Conferencing?
With Zoom, users can connect with each other and share video, audio, phone calls, and chat sessions via a unified communications platform. It is necessary to have an internet connection as well as a device that is compatible with Zoom in order to use it. New users usually want to start by registering for a Zoom account and downloading the Zoom Client for Meetings as the first step. How to use Zoom for beginners
Join a Zoom meeting
-
The meeting invitation will be provided to you in your inbox or in your calendar when you open your email.
-
Click on the Zoom meeting link when you have found it and join the meeting. It is likely that most invitations will have a link that says “Join Zoom Meeting” at the top of the invitation.
-
In the event that Zoom is prompted for opening, click Allow.

Start a Zoom meeting
-
You can reach the Zoom web portal by logging in and clicking on the Meetings tab.
-
Once you have located your scheduled meeting, hover your cursor over it and click Start.
Note: You can schedule a meeting if you don’t have any scheduled meetings on the calendar at the moment. On the next page, you will need to fill out the required information and click Save. Once you have selected the meeting entry, hover your mouse over it and click the Start button. -
A Zoom meeting will automatically be launched once the Zoom application is launched.
